Q: Legal implication of smoking in the flats balcony

Hi, I am a resident of an apartment in Bangalore, I want to know is their any law that stops me from smoking in my flat Balcony or inside my flat. Do someone has authority to take any legal action.

Advocate Geetha D Philip answered
Yes the Association if registered can take legal action against ,for nuisance . Meanwhile it is prudent to behave yourself to avoid discord.There are provisions to penalise you with fine if not obliging.

Q: Can a lawyer be the witness for sale agreement by his wife

Myself and my husband signed an agreement for purchase of a flat in Bengaluru which was owned by a lady. Her Husband who was a lawyer offered us all help to draft the agreement. He has also signed as a witness. Is it legally permitted?

Advocate Geetha D Philip answered
Yes you can proceed with the purchase. If you disagree with any clause in the Agreement you can request it to be changed as per law.It is safe to make legal dependents of the seller consenting witness in the Sale Deed too.If you still have any doubt regarding title of the flat you can contact me for verification along with EC and recent tax paid receipt of the flat.
